About

North Central and Dartmouth Circus sit on the northern edge of Birmingham city centre, where the inner ring road meets routes heading out of town. The area contains a mix of housing, small workshops, offices and street-level retail, with frequent bus corridors and pedestrian links into the centre. Dartmouth Circus itself functions as a major traffic gyratory and the point where the short motorway that leads north from the city begins; that route’s wide single-carriageway profile is a visible marker of postwar road planning here. Local blocks include short terraces, mid-rise commercial buildings and parcels of land that have seen phased redevelopment over recent decades.

On foot the area feels utilitarian: businesses that serve the city arrive here for easy vehicle access and practical space, while secondary shopping and takeaways cater to commuters and nearby residents. Small green pockets and tree-lined streets sit between built plots, and cycle routes run parallel to the main road corridors. Movement and access define the neighbourhood, with frequent bus services and short walks to central rail and tram interchanges.

Area overview

On average North Central & Dartmouth Circus has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 233 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 43.7%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in North Central & Dartmouth Circus is £37,783 per year. There are 17 schools in North Central & Dartmouth Circus: 5 primary (0 Outstanding and 3 Good) and 5 secondary (1 Outstanding and 2 Good). North Central & Dartmouth Circus is home to around 16,085 people, with a population density of about 5,024.4 per km2.

Property prices in North Central & Dartmouth Circus

Based on 28 recent sales, the median property price is £263,125 in North Central & Dartmouth Circus area, with individual transactions ranging from £120,000 up to £500,400.
